Heads up for folks new to the Userhive split: the extraction of the profile module from the Cortexa monolith stalled last week because the staging credentials for the shim layer expired. Nothing's broken in prod, but the migration job can't sync accounts until the shim can auth again. Rotation is handled by the Keywheel service, but someone disabled the cron during the freeze. To unblock, update the shim's config with the freshly issued key below.

app token of bawep-hafog = kto7_vwrmnlx

**Alert: Intermittent DNS resolution failures — Marlowe service mesh**

Resolution for upstream hosts in the Tarn cluster fails sporadically, typically under cache-expiry bursts. Retries usually succeed within two attempts, so customer impact is low, but sustained failures indicate resolver pool exhaustion. Mitigation steps and the resolver tuning history are tracked here:

wiki page, bagaf-fawip: https://harbor.tolvaqsys.local/pages/repo/pages/secrets/eac969ffc71f356b

## Deploy Step 4: Websocket Reconnect Fix

This release patches the Tollgate chat widget's reconnect loop. Support: after deploy, stale sessions may drop once; clients reconnect automatically within ten seconds. No user action needed. Verify WS_HEARTBEAT_MS=15000 in the env file. The reconnect handshake now validates against the Marrowby session service, which means the env file needs this line added:

sealed setting: ARCHIVE_KEY3=8d0